### RestockPilot: Release Prerequisites

Before cutting a release, confirm that the RestockPilot planner can reach the SnackGrid inventory service, since the build pipeline runs an integration smoke test against staging during packaging. A failed handshake here blocks the release tag, so verify credentials first. The pipeline reads its staging credential from the deploy config; for reference and manual verification, the current key appears below.

service key, tajof-fawip: vxb4-JNOz

Security-relevant note: scale decisions are signed by the controller, and any unsigned scaling request is rejected and recorded in the audit stream — review those rejections before assuming a capacity problem, as threshold abuse has been used to probe quota limits. Response steps, audit queries, and the freeze-override procedure are documented on the internal page below.

runbook for badug-kadup: https://confluence.zemvarlabs.internal/projects/browse/display/projects/bd1b

Subject: Transcode farm access for Veldora integration

Hi Veldora team,

Before you review the PR wiring your ingest hooks into our Pixelmill transcoding farm, note that each worker pulls jobs from the Quenby queue and reports progress via the status API. Rate limits are per-tenant, so please keep concurrency at or below eight workers during the pilot. All calls must be authenticated against the staging gateway. Use the staging bearer token below.

login token, yawig-kagaf: eyJhbGciOiJIUzI1NiIsInR5cCI6IkpXVCJ9.eyJzdWIiOiIlAlfV7MEnpIn0.t7OupPTrg_dn